![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ы
![]() |
Поиск в этой теме
![]() |
![]() |
#1 |
Пользователь
Регистрация: 05.11.2011
Сообщений: 56
|
![]()
Привет форумчанам!
Такой вопрос: форму подробного объявления надо выводить только тогда, когда существует пер-я details (короче, если пользователь нажал на ссылку), а получается если раз нажал на ссылку и выбрал другой параметр поиска, то форма все равно вылазит в контетн. Как обнулить эту ссылку? Или как сделать так, чтобы форма выводилась только когда надо, а не все время вылазила...? Благодарю за внимание! PHP код:
Последний раз редактировалось Pingvinenok_Lolo; 29.03.2012 в 01:38. Причина: Дополнила код |
![]() |
![]() |
![]() |
#2 |
Участник клуба
Регистрация: 28.06.2009
Сообщений: 1,950
|
![]()
Вы имеете в виду, если в URL кроме details появляется ещё что-то? Проверяйте на наличие других параметров в $_GET
|
![]() |
![]() |
![]() |
#3 |
Пользователь
Регистрация: 05.11.2011
Сообщений: 56
|
![]()
Сначала у меня идет форма поиска, так вот, когда посылаю в форме $_POST-запрос, то массив $_GET должен очищаться, а он остается неизменным, поэтому и форма подробного объявления все время висит на странице, как от этого избавиться?
|
![]() |
![]() |
![]() |
#4 | |
Старожил
Регистрация: 31.05.2010
Сообщений: 3,301
|
![]() Цитата:
Код HTML:
<form action="" method="post">
Хотите очистить GET при использовании формы - указывайте обработчик в атрибуте action явно. |
|
![]() |
![]() |
![]() |
#5 |
Пользователь
Регистрация: 05.11.2011
Сообщений: 56
|
![]()
Andkorol, Точно! Не указала значение action! Исправила, работает Спасибо Вам огромнейшее!!!!
Вообще-то задумка такая, хочу сделать вывод контента примерно как на этом сайте http://dompoisk.com/kvartira16693.htm чтобы инфа также выводилась: таблица с инфой, а подробности конкретного объявления вверху перед выводом таблицы. Как такое можно реализовать? |
![]() |
![]() |
![]() |
#6 |
Старожил
Регистрация: 31.05.2010
Сообщений: 3,301
|
![]() |
![]() |
![]() |
![]() |
#7 |
Пользователь
Регистрация: 05.11.2011
Сообщений: 56
|
![]()
Что конкретно я делаю см. код в первом посте, а не получается выводить форму "подробно объявления" перед таблицей, т.е. сейчас у меня код написан так, что подробности выводятся в конце страницы (впереди идут 20 записей объектов например и аж в самом конце подробная инфа по конкретному объявлению), это не совсем красиво и не читабельно для пользователя. Как выводить форму в начале? Нужно какое-то условие для вывода контента и вот на этом условии зависла я )))
|
![]() |
![]() |
![]() |
#8 |
Старожил
Регистрация: 31.05.2010
Сообщений: 3,301
|
![]() |
![]() |
![]() |
![]() |
#9 |
Пользователь
Регистрация: 05.11.2011
Сообщений: 56
|
![]()
А где мне тогда id взять для конкретного объявления,id получаю из первого запроса и использую его далее. Ну перемещу я этот кусок кода в начало и получаю НЕИЗВЕСТНЫЙ ИДЕНТИФИКАТОР id
|
![]() |
![]() |
![]() |
#10 | ||
Старожил
Регистрация: 31.05.2010
Сообщений: 3,301
|
![]() Цитата:
Цитата:
Только, плиз - не используйте данные из POST & GET в запросах к MySQL без обработки или экранирования хотя-бы, это же явная SQL-injection. |
||
![]() |
![]() |
![]() |
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
слайдер контента | CodeNOT | JavaScript, Ajax | 1 | 04.10.2011 01:23 |
Просмотр нового контента в IE | Lindemann66 | HTML и CSS | 2 | 10.08.2011 12:23 |
Вывод div блока на главной | XPsihopaTX | PHP | 12 | 06.01.2011 19:05 |
задача с обновлением Memo и сразу последующим его заполнением инфой по сети | NiKiToZZ- | Помощь студентам | 5 | 29.12.2010 12:55 |
Менеджер контента | Insainer | HTML и CSS | 1 | 27.04.2008 11:06 |